A jackknifed semi-truck has resulted in the closure of all northbound lanes on Interstate 15 at Lamb Boulevard, according to the Nevada Highway Patrol. The incident is causing significant delays for commuters and travelers in the area.

Lastly, as rain showers sweep across the Las Vegas valley, the Southern Nevada Water Authority is urging residents to turn off their irrigation systems for a week, marking a shift in water conservation efforts in response to the weather.
